Lift maintenance runs every Saturday 07:00–13:00 at Marrowgate Tower. Contractors from Veylift Services will use Lift B only. Direct all weekend arrivals to the stairwell or service lift. Do not hold lift doors or override calls during this window. Log contractor arrivals in the desk book. The service lift requires the weekend access code below.

staff pass of kawip-hawef = bdg-QLP-2

09:47 — During the Merrowfield ORM refactor, the legacy query builder's string-interpolation path was finally removed from the Caldus billing adapter. A review flagged that two raw-query escape hatches remained reachable via the admin console; both were gated behind the new parameterized shim before rollout resumed. The remediated artifact is identified by the token below.

session token of kageg-tahop = htk14_af3c1ccccb7dcf

Handover note — Crumbwheel order cutoffs.

Welcome aboard. The bakery cutoff rule in Crumbwheel closes same-day orders at 14:00 local to each storefront, not UTC — this has bitten us twice. Holiday overrides live in the calendar service and take precedence silently, so always check there first when a cutoff looks wrong. To unlock the calendar service's admin console after a restart, enter the recovery passphrase below.

vault phrase of bagap-bahaf = silion-pelox-sorox-casdor-quenwyn-fraax-eliox-praael-kelion-quenvan-kasox-rusael-norius-belvan